Tabela de conteúdos

~~ODT~~

Última atualização: 2017/07/12 11:45 por allan.bueno

Juntada de Processos

Juntada é a união de um processo a outro, com o qual se tenha relação ou dependência, pode ser por Anexação ou Apensação. A juntada deverá ser efetuada em ordem cronológica de apresentação de documentos, ou seja, na sequência em que os documentos, informações e decisões se apresentarem como relevantes para o Assunto em questão.

A juntada pode ser de dois tipos:

Pré-condições:

Descrição do Caso de Uso

Esse caso de uso pode ser acessado através do link: SIPAC → Módulo Protocolo → Processos → Juntada → Juntada de Processos

Passo 1

Assim que o caso de uso é iniciado, o usuário deverá selecionar o tipo de juntada:

Tipo de juntada

Passo 2

Após são mostrados todos os processos que encontram-se na unidade do usuário logado. Através da opção Buscar Processo, o sistema irá filtrar o resultado da consulta de acordo com os parâmetros informados:

São exibidas informações conforme o fluxo de consulta de processos. (RN01 e RN02):

Passo 3

No passo seguinte são exibidas informações sobre o processo principal selecionado anteriormente.

Abaixo são mostrados os processos já juntados ao processo principal durante esse passo:

Logo após, são mostrados todos os processos que encontram-se na unidade do usuário. Através da opção Buscar Processo, o sistema irá filtrar o resultado da consulta de acordo com os parâmetros informados:

Em seguida, são discriminadas as seguintes informações na relação dos processos encontrados na unidade do usuário (RN01 e RN02):

O usuário deverá selecionar os processos que deseja juntar ao processo principal e selecionar a opção correspondente ao tipo de juntada escolhido, Apensar Processos ou Anexar Processos.

Para cada processo, o usuário tem a opção de Remover Processo Acessório, que remove o processo da lista de processos juntados.

Após a conclusão da seleção dos processos a serem juntados clique em Continuar para prosseguir

Passo 4

Nesse passo, são exibidas informações sobre o processo principal:

E também são exibidas informações sobre os processos acessórios selecionados anteriormente.

Abaixo, o usuário deverá informar o responsável e o texto ou arquivo do despacho que irá autorizar a juntada (RN04, RN08 e RN09).

Ao confirmar a operação o usuário é direcionado para uma página de sucesso.

Passo 5

Na página de sucesso, serão mostrados os Dados da Juntada de Processos:

Após, são exibidos os Dados Gerais do Processo Principal:

Seguido pelas informações sobre os processos acessórios juntados:

E os Dados Gerais do Despacho:

O termo da juntada gerado será um novo documento anexo ao processo principal da juntada. (RN14).



Após a autorização da juntada, os processos tramitam juntos e nenhuma operação pode ser realizada no processo acessório (RN05). Todas as tramitações realizadas no processo principal devem ser replicadas nos processos acessórios (RN06).

O caso de uso é finalizado.

Principais Regras de Negócio

Resoluções/Legislações Associadas

PORTARIA NORMATIVA Nº 5, DE 19 DE DEZEMBRO DE 2002: Dispõe sobre os procedimentos gerais para utilização dos serviços de protocolo, no âmbito da Administração Pública Federal, para os órgãos e entidades integrantes do Sistema de Serviços Gerais - SISG.

Plano de Teste

Sistema: SIPAC

Módulo: Protocolo

Link(s): Processos → Juntada → Juntada de Processos

Usuário: marcilia (secretaria SINFO), zania (patrimônio) e paulinho (patrimônio).

Papel que usuário deve ter: ProtocoloPapeis.CADASTRAR_PROTOCOLO.

Cenários de Teste

Dados para o Teste

Consulta para verificar se as movimentações do processo principal estão sendo replicadas nos processos acessórios.

 
-- Consulta para conferir movimentações
 
SELECT p.id_movimento_atual, m.* FROM protocolo.movimento m
    INNER JOIN protocolo.processo p ON p.id_processo = m.id_processo
    LEFT JOIN (SELECT m2.id_movimento_principal FROM protocolo.movimento m2 WHERE m2.id_movimento_principal IS NOT NULL) AS m2 ON m2.id_movimento_principal = m.id_movimento
 
WHERE m.id_movimento_principal IS NOT NULL OR m2.id_movimento_principal IS NOT NULL

Para a RN07, podemos usar:

SELECT pa.nome, u.login
FROM comum.usuario_unidade uu
     JOIN comum.usuario u ON u.id_usuario = uu.id_usuario
     JOIN comum.pessoa p ON p.id_pessoa = u.id_pessoa
     JOIN comum.unidade un ON un.id_unidade = uu.id_unidade
     JOIN comum.permissao pe ON pe.id_usuario = u.id_usuario
     JOIN comum.papel pa ON pa.id = pe.id_papel
WHERE pe.id_papel = 6
GROUP BY pe.id_unidade_papel, pa.nome, u.login, uu.id_usuario
ORDER BY u.login
SELECT pa.nome, u.login, un.codigo_unidade, un.nome
FROM comum.usuario u
     JOIN comum.permissao pe ON pe.id_usuario = u.id_usuario
     JOIN comum.papel pa ON pa.id = pe.id_papel
     JOIN comum.unidade un ON un.id_unidade = pe.id_unidade_papel
WHERE u.login LIKE '<LOGIN DO USUÁRIO>'
AND pe.id_papel = 6

Para alterar os parâmetros da RN10 E RN11, podemos usar:

UPDATE comum.parametro SET valor = 'true' WHERE nome = 'UTILIZA_TIPO_PROCESSO'
UPDATE comum.parametro SET valor = 'true' WHERE nome = 'UTILIZA_CLASSIFICACAO_CONARQ'